The synthesis of polymers with ultra‐high molecular weight by combining ROMP and acyclic metathesis reaction

Linzhi Xie,
Yunfeng Zhou,
Xiaoming Zhu
et al.

Abstract: Ring opening metathesis polymerization (ROMP) is widely used to prepare functional materials with various topological structures. However, it is difficult to prepare polymers with ultra‐high molecular weight (UHMW) directly. We found a new method to prepare UHMW polymers by combining ROMP and acyclic metathesis reaction. First, monomer NB‐2OH was polymerized by ROMP with different feed ratio of NB‐2OH/G3, and obtained well‐defined polymers P(NB‐2OH)n (n = 50, 200, and 463).
